How to Start a Shelter Workshop

Every other month, Shelter Partnership conducts a workshop, at no charge to attendees, on how to start and operate short-term housing programs for homeless persons. The workshop provides basic information such as:  creating a nonprofit corporation, program design, obstacles, siting issues, and other resources.  Please contact Stephanie Stapleton to register.

Library

Shelter Partnership, Inc. has a small library which contains local, regional, and national studies, reports, and other literature on homelessness and housing. Library materials are divided into various subject categories (e.g., Homeless Families, HIV/AIDS Housing, Funding Programs, etc.). There are over 5,000 documents in the library, dating back to the 1980's when homelessness escalated.

The library is open to the public by appointment only, weekdays, 9:15 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Library materials may not be removed from the library but may be photocopied for 5¢ per page. To make an appointment, contact Shelter Partnership at (213) 688-2188.
